Gruntwork, the company behind Terragrunt, is on a mission to transform the way DevOps is done. Let's face it: designing, launching, and managing infrastructure is still a terrible experience for most organizations, but it doesn't have to be that way!
We are globally recognized both for our open source tools (Terragrunt, Terratest, cloud-nuke) used by thousands of companies from startups to Fortune 500s, and our thought leadership on how DevOps should be done.
Our commercial offerings include:
Gruntwork AWS Accelerator: An opinionated, best-practices solution that accelerates a company's journey to a secure, compliant, and well-architected IaC setup on AWS.
Terragrunt Scale: A suite of enterprise-grade tools including our IaC Pipeline, Patcher, and Drift Detection to help organizations manage IaC at scale
Gruntwork is a profitable, bootstrapped company without any outside investors. We operate as a lean, capital efficient startup and our team is made up of values-aligned, hard-working and independently capable individuals.

About the company:
No investors, no debt. We control our own destiny and are focused on building a company that customers love.
100% remote. We've been 100% remote from day 1, however we're all in USA time zones and regularly collaborate together.
In-person meetups every few months. We meet in person every ~4 months in a beautiful location to foster close relationships among our team.
Transparent financials. We share our full financials every month with every member of the company.
Systematically above-market salary. We compute all salaries using a formula designed to systematically pay above market, wherever you live.
Above-market equity. We offer above-market equity grants, and we've even put in place a “progressive equity” plan where if there is a large exit event, employees end up with a progressively larger portion of the proceeds than their pro-rata equity holdings.
Profit-sharing bonus. We set aside a pot of money at the end of each year based on profits and distribute bonuses according to a formula that uses as inputs your level within the company and the length of your tenure at the company.
Hardware budget. We'll buy you a brand new state-of-the-art 16" Apple MacBook Pro (or other computer of your choosing of equivalent value) upon joining. It will be owned by you, not the company.
Personal budget. We'll give you a personal budget of $1,000 USD per month (yes, per month) to spend on your workspace (e.g., a co-working space), health (e.g., gym, yoga), time (e.g., babysitter), and/or learning (e.g., books, courses).
Medical/Dental/Vision insurance. We offer a range of high-quality plans with a large portion paid by the company. For countries other than the US, this includes extra coverage on top of your statutory insurance.
Pension/401(k) contributions. We contribute 3% of your salary to your pension or 401(k).
